Discover the most popular places to visit in Beaver
Tushar Mountains

Utah's third-highest range offers rugged alpine terrain and diverse ecosystems without the crowds. Explore dense forests, meadows, and lakes through hiking trails or enjoy winter skiing at this serene mountain escape.
Mirror Lake
This pristine alpine lake mirrors the majestic Uinta Mountains in its crystal-clear waters. Spend a day fishing for rainbow trout or paddling a canoe across its reflective surface at 10,400 feet elevation.
Main Street Park
8.2/10 (50 reviews)
This welcoming community space features a lighted ball field, pavilion, and historical monuments including artillery pieces. Relax with a picnic under the pavilion while experiencing the heart of Beaver's local heritage.
Eagle Point Ski Resort
9.0/10 (89 reviews)
Escape the crowds at Eagle Point Resort, where 650 acres of Tushar Mountain terrain awaits with 40 diverse runs. Experience the magic of Powder Fridays when fresh snow blankets the mountain after midweek storms.
Otter Lake
Tucked within Utah's Tushar Mountains, Otter Lake rewards visitors with pristine alpine serenity and wildlife sightings. Explore surrounding trails when summer wildflowers frame this tranquil high-altitude retreat.
North Creek Recreation Site
A tranquil outdoor space where locals enjoy fishing and picnicking along the creek. Visitors can explore the natural surroundings and observe wildlife in this peaceful retreat.
Beaver Library
This 1918 Carnegie Library blends historic architecture with modern services in a peaceful setting. Browse the collection or inquire about its storied past while enjoying the adjacent park.
Canyon Breeze Golf Course
Canyon Breeze Golf Course features a unique 7th hole tee box situated within a horse racing track. Navigate tree-lined fairways and strategic water hazards while enjoying the relaxed atmosphere of this 9-hole Utah gem.
